A new unit commitment model considering wind power and pumped storage power station

摘要

This paper presents a new unit commitment model to solve the optimal operation considering volatility and anti peaking characteristics of wind power. Considering the advantages of flexible regulation and storage, pumped storage power station is introduced in this paper. The model decomposes the question into two sub problems: first, using of pumped storage power station to smooth net load power; then distributing the smoothed system power in thermal power units. To demonstrate the effectiveness of the proposed model, the testing is performed in a simplified generation system. The result shows that a proper operating can be reached with the proposed method.
